Selling the House

Folks, I know this question will get a lot of different responses but I know I'm asking the experts...

Glenda and I will retire within the next couple of years and have considered fulltiming. One of the biggest fears we have results from stories where people have sold their homes only to not be able to afford to buy back into the market when fulltiming comes to an end.

Can you folks please share some of your experiences on this and any advice you can give on this topic.
